Dark matter search results from the commissioning run of PandaX-II

We present the results of a search for weakly interacting massive particles (WIMPs) from the commissioning run of the PandaX-II experiment located at the China Jinping Underground Laboratory. A WIMP search data set with an exposure of $306\ifmmode\times\else\texttimes\fi{}19.1\text{ }\text{ }\mathrm{kg}\text{\ensuremath{-}}\text{day}$ was taken, while its dominant $^{85}\mathrm{Kr}$ background was used as the electron recoil calibration. No WIMP candidates are identified, and a 90% upper limit is set on the spin-independent elastic WIMP-nucleon cross section with a lowest excluded cross section of $2.97\ifmmode\times\else\texttimes\fi{}{10}^{\ensuremath{-}45}\text{ }\text{ }{\mathrm{cm}}^{2}$ at a WIMP mass of $44.7\text{ }\text{ }\mathrm{GeV}/{\mathrm{c}}^{2}$.
